LexisNexis(R) Appoints New Managing Director in India

LexisNexis, a leading global provider of business information solutions today announced that John Atkinson has been named Managing Director for LexisNexis Butterworths India. Effective immediately, he will be based in New Delhi and report directly to Doug Kaplan, CEO of LexisNexis Asia Pacific.

Atkinson joined LexisNexis in 2005 as Managing Director of LexisNexis Asia, which included oversight of the company's Indian business that has experienced substantial growth due to changing business and legal trends. As Managing Director he will be responsible for meeting expanding customer needs brought about by a growing economy, globalization and a need to streamline processes. LexisNexis, as part of its global expansion strategy aims to be the number one print and electronic, legal, tax and regulatory publisher in India, Atkinson is responsible for driving this initiative.

Known in India as LexisNexis Butterworths, the company has developed a strong reputation for its premium law, taxation and regulatory publications. Today, LexisNexis has offices in New Delhi and Chennai and a third more recently, in Mumbai.

"The market for legal information and services in India is expansive and robust," said Atkinson. "By combining our premium information and technology services, we are well positioned to enable our customers to control costs, increase efficiency, reduce cycle time and mitigate risk."

Atkinson has extensive experience in information and technology-based organizations throughout Asia. Prior to LexisNexis, Atkinson was Executive Director of GAVS Information Services Pvt Ltd, an IT and Business Process Outsourcing company. Earlier he was the Chief Executive Officer of Asia Converge Pte Ltd, a joint venture between the Singapore Stock Exchange, DBS and OCBC that focused on Business Process Outsourcing for the Securities market.

Formerly, Atkinson spent 17 years with Reuters based in Sweden, the UK, the Arabian Gulf, the Philippines, India and Singapore. He was responsible for significant growth and success of Reuters India Limited during his time as Managing Director based in Mumbai in the late 1990's.

"John's first hand knowledge of the Indian market and experience in media and information services makes him an excellent choice to lead the expansion of LexisNexis in India," said Douglas Kaplan, CEO of LexisNexis Asia Pacific.

LexisNexis(R) Expands Intellectual Property Solutions to Help Customers Protect Valuable Assets

Designed to help customers protect valuable Intellectual Property (IP) assets, LexisNexis introduced a new solution called IP DataDirect-Patents and unveiled enhancements to its suite of IP services. Additionally, LexisNexis announced it received an award nomination for TotalPatent.
By expanding one of the most comprehensive databases of IP sources available, LexisNexis(R) customers have the ability to research full-text patents from 22 patenting authorities and more than 500 full-text Elsevier Science Journals.
The TotalPatent(TM) service now includes the world's most complete full-text source of granted patents - including searchable PDFs - issued by the United Kingdom Intellectual Property Office, formerly the British Patent Office, from 1982 to current.
The company introduced IP DataDirect-Patents, which allows customers to directly access IP information and populate that information into internal proprietary systems, to join the rapidly growing suite of global IP solutions from LexisNexis, which includes lexis.com(R), TotalPatent, PatentOptimizer(TM), Global IP Law Service, REEDFAX(R), and exclusive analytical content.
"Protecting valuable assets - including patents, trademarks, copyrights, and trade secrets - is one of the most important tasks facing business and legal professionals today," said Peter Vanderheyden, vice president of Global Intellectual Property at LexisNexis. "The enhancements to LexisNexis Intellectual Property solutions are designed to help our customers make better business decisions by confidently developing, protecting and maintaining their valuable IP assets."

LexisNexis(R) IP DataDirect-Patents

A new addition to the suite of IP services is LexisNexis(R) IP DataDirect-Patents, which allows customers to directly access IP information and populate that information into internal proprietary systems. Customers who license data through IP DataDirect-Patents gain access to an unmatched collection of full-text data from 22 patent authorities - more sources than available from any other single provider.

IP DataDirect-Patents includes:

-- Bibliographic and abstract data from 96 authorities

-- English-language machine translations

-- Clipped images

-- Legal status, forward and backward citations, and patent-family data

-- PDF images in searchable, bookmarked, and compressed format

The data is supplied in XML ST.36 format, which is the World Intellectual Property Organization's standard for patent data. Daily updates are available through an FTP site 24 hours per day.

TotalPatent, PatentOptimizer Enhancements

LexisNexis is helping TotalPatent customers enhance their data analysis through a number of new features and services. For example, TotalPatent data is now available in an XML download, allowing customers to receive data for use in internal analytic or database systems. For customers looking to maximize the TotalPatent experience, LexisNexis is making its comprehensive help manual available as a downloadable PDF.

Additionally, customers can use a new inventor/assignee look-up tool that allows them to search by the author of the patent. This allows them to perform analytics and to glean business intelligence from analysis of inventors and assignees. TotalPatent is now organized into patent families, enabling users to trace the original filing, as well as equivalent filings in other jurisdictions.

LexisNexis enhancements to PatentOptimizer are designed to help customers streamline the patent process and protect valuable assets. For example, PatentOptimizer will support patent links that navigate directly into the TotalPatent service, allowing customers to check terms and references, as well as verify citations. Additionally, customers verifying claims can immediately compare and navigate multiple claim sets across a series of user-identified documents.

About LexisNexis

LexisNexis(R) (www.lexisnexis.com) is a leading global provider of business information solutions to a wide range of professionals in the legal, risk management, corporate, government, law enforcement, accounting and academic markets. LexisNexis originally pioneered online information with its Lexis(R) and Nexis(R) services. A member of Reed Elsevier (NYSE:ENL)(NYSE:RUK) (www.reedelsevier.com), LexisNexis serves customers in more than 100 countries with 13,000 employees worldwide.
